The Cole County Sheriff's Department is joining other law enforcement agencies in asking for the public's help in trying to find a Jefferson City 16-year-old girl.

The sheriff's department said Friday they received a report on Jan. 5 that Lindsey Marie Miller had apparently left town with her boyfriend Sergio Sayles, 25.

Her mother told authorities Lindsey was not taken against her will.

Sayles, according to the Missouri Highway Patrol, is wanted by law enforcement agencies and is considered armed and dangerous.

A check of court records shows Sayles has a case pending from September of last year where he is charged with second-degree domestic assault in Cole County.

He has pleaded guilty to two cases of felony stealing from August 2008 and May 2011.

Miller and Sayles are believed to be traveling in a dark blue Dodge Stratus with Illinois license plate N416204 and are believed to be going to the state of California.

The last contact they had with anyone was in the state of Arizona.

Since indications are they crossed state lines, the FBI has been notified.

Lindsey is described as having blonde hair, blue eyes, standing 5 feet tall and weighing 130 pounds.

Anyone with information that could lead authorities to this pair should call the sheriff's department at (573) 634-9160, the TIPS Hotline at (573) 659-TIPS or the Missouri Highway Patrol Missing Persons Clearinghouse at 573-526-6178.
